Forum更新、バグ多数(sidekiq停止中)

フォーラムは2日前に「2025年2月安定版」(正確なバージョン番号を見つける方法がわからない)に更新されました。

メンバーがいくつかのバグに気づいています。

  • 返信の通知が届かない。
  • 返信を見るために手動でページを更新する必要がある。
  • 「オンライン中のユーザー」プラグインが誤作動しており、実際には50人以上オンラインであると表示されている。

これを修正するにはどうすればよいですか?修正パッチ(hot fix)などはリリースされる予定はありますか?

よろしくお願いします。
Shaun

ホスティングでも、他のセルフホスティングユーザーからもこれらの問題は報告されていないため、お客様のサーバー固有の問題である可能性が高いです。関連する修正プログラムは現在予定されていません。

症状から判断すると、Sidekiq(バックグラウンドジョブプロセッサ)が正しく動作していないようです。

フォーラムの /logs にアクセスした際に、最近のエラーは表示されていますか?

/sidekiq はどのように表示されますか?ジョブが処理されていることは表示されていますか?

「いいね!」 2

最近いくつかのエラーが発生しています。

Sidekiqは機能しているように見えますか?

(編集:実際には機能していないことがわかりました…これは初めて見ました lol)

通知がたくさん来ましたが、どうやらスタックしていたようです。Sidekiqにアクセスしたことで、それが解消されたのでしょうか?

「いいね!」 1

ああ、ホストが私のメッセージに返信してくれたようです。彼らがそれをキックしたようです…彼らが何を言うか見てみます。ありがとう!!

「いいね!」 2

面白いですね!正直なところ、ダッシュボードを訪問することがそれを後押しするとは思いませんが、可能性はあります!

ダッシュボードの上部にある数字はどのようになっていますか?

正常な状態では、「enqueued」の数はゼロに近い必要があります。もし何かが詰まっている場合、その数は非常に高く、0まで処理されるのに時間がかかる可能性があります。

ああ、それは素晴らしいです!

「いいね!」 2

Sidekiqは(順調に)動作していましたが、3.4へのアップデート以降、約1000件のジョブがキューに入ったままスタックしているようでした。アップデートではリベイクや非同期処理がよく行われるため、私たちはそれを特に怪しいとは思いませんでした。

プロセスの再起動で解決しました。原因はオンライン状態プラグインではないかと疑っていますが、100%確信しているわけではありません。

「いいね!」 1

おそらく関係ありませんが、最近のアップデート後に Sidekiq が誤作動している可能性のあるものも 見つけました

また、

偶然かどうかはわかりませんが、管理者の1人が過去24時間にこれを目撃しましたが、まだ再現できていないため、単一の不具合だった可能性があります。

私もこの問題が発生しました。

Sidekiqダッシュボードには何もアクティブなものが表示されず、5つのジョブスロットすべてが21時間前のジョブで埋まっていたため、Sidekiqは新しいジョブを一切プルしておらず、エンキューされたカウントは増加していました。いずれにせよシステムアップデートを適用する必要があったため、システムを再起動したところ、問題が解決しました。

オンライン中のキューが増加しているのが最初の兆候でした。

Sidekiqダッシュボードにアクセスしても、「キック」にはなりませんでした。

さらに、Discourseダッシュボードでこの警告に気づきました。

これは、UIのどこかに表示されなかった警告を意味するのではないかと疑問に思っています。最後のアップデート(176ee0bf60)の直後には、この警告には気づきませんでした。ダッシュボードを頻繁にチェックしないため、いつ表示されたかはわかりません。

「いいね!」 1

このトピックは、最後の返信から30日後に自動的にクローズされました。新しい返信は許可されていません。